E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Tiny4412
第十一章、
Tiny4412
U-BOOT移植十一 DDR3简单介绍
由于
Tiny4412
所用的芯片是DDR3,我从网上找一片介绍DDR3的原理的博文,虽然很多原理是一致的,但还是想着这些资料难搜集,而且多看一次除了费点时间外,我想不到别的坏处,那就在看一次,以便以后在修改代码时
eshing
·
2020-06-23 06:52
tiny4412
U-Boot
移植
第十三章、
Tiny4412
U-BOOT移植十三 DDR3初始化源码分析
DMCmustassertandholdCKEtoalogiclowleveltoprovidestablepowerformemorydeviceandthenapplystableclock.设置DMC,由于时钟已经在clock_init_my
tiny4412
eshing
·
2020-06-23 06:52
tiny4412
U-Boot
移植
第十二章、
Tiny4412
U-BOOT移植十二 DDR3初始化顺序
现在网上很难搜到Exynos4412的源码,基本上我没有找到任何资料有过分析DDR3的内存初始化代码的。在看U-Boot的这段代码时,也徘徊了很久,不知道如下手,很多文章或资料都将这一段分析过程有意无意的隐藏掉了,最多也只是提一下说参考裸板的代码,在找不到任何资料的情况下,我只能依靠芯片手册上,三星在内存控制器这一章,写的关于DDR3的初始化顺序的21个步骤来一条一条去读去看,在安静下来看了芯片手
eshing
·
2020-06-23 06:20
tiny4412
U-Boot
移植
第八章、
Tiny4412
U-BOOT移植八 SDRAM工作时序与原理
DDR出身自SDRAM,严格的说应该叫DDRSDRAM,DDRSDRAM是DoubleDataRateSDRAM的缩写,是双倍速率同步动态随机存储器的意思,所以,有很大一部分,两者是一样的,理解SDRAM,然后再来理解DDR。在SDRAM上的改进,效果应该更好一些,这里要感谢Chinaunix.net的大神--TekkamanNinja,我的内存的学习资料都是TekkamanNinja的博客中介绍
eshing
·
2020-06-23 06:20
tiny4412
U-Boot
移植
arm-linux-gcc: 没有那个文件或目录
转载:http://www.techbulo.com/1236.html最近弄了个4412的板子(友善之臂的
Tiny4412
增强版),准备搞搞android,开发服务器用的是Ubuntu12.04-64bit
水天一一色
·
2020-06-22 12:46
嵌入式开发
交叉编译
linux
没有那个文件或目录
QT界面与视频同时显示在屏幕上
网上有的介绍
tiny4412
平台所以没有在一个显示屏幕上有FB0,FB1,FB2...我的设备两个显示屏幕:HDMI对应fb0,TV对应fb1;解决方法:在程序中有TI81XXFB
为了维护世界和平
·
2020-06-22 07:21
TI
QT
成功在Tiny 4412 开发板上 移植 ffmpeg,搞定了手册上USB摄像头不能摄像录制功能!!!
移植的过程还是有点艰辛的,
Tiny4412
ADK开发板上手册说要使用录制功能,需要购买配套的CMOS摄像头,哈哈,我偏不信。
我最爱吃大白兔
·
2020-06-21 04:07
【
Tiny4412
】搭建Qt网络文件系统
00.目录文章目录00.目录01.编译内核02.烧写Linux内核03.烧写Qt根分区映像04.搭建Qt网络文件系统05.附录01.编译内核1.1解压内核源码[root@itcasttools]#tar-xjvflinux-3.5_analyse.tar.bz21.2配置内核[
[email protected]
_analyse]#makeclean[
[email protected]
_
沧海一笑-dj
·
2020-06-08 21:16
ARM
【
Tiny4412
】
Tiny4412
编译和烧写uboot
00.目录文章目录00.目录01.Uboot简介02.安装交叉编译器03.编译Uboot04.烧写Uboot05.测试Uboot06.常见问题解决07.附录01.Uboot简介1.1Uboot概述U-Boot,全称UniversalBootLoader,是遵循GPL条款的开放源码项目。U-Boot的作用是系统引导。U-Boot从FADSROM、8xxROM、PPCBOOT逐步发展演化而来。其源码目
沧海一笑-dj
·
2020-06-04 17:18
ARM
libusb移植到Android开发板
这是我在上的第一篇文章,就以迁移libusb到Android开发板为例,整理出本人遇到的问题及解决方法,希望对有需要的朋友有所帮助:使用环境环境:Ubuntu14.04,
tiny4412
(Android
zzkzsmj
·
2020-03-31 14:41
基于iTop-4412的U-Boot 2017移植[1]:成功运行
基于iTop-4412的U-Boot2017移植[1]:成功运行参考资料:Exynos4412的启动过程分析基于
tiny4412
的u-boot移植获取U-Boot本博客使用的版本是U-Boot2017.05
techping
·
2020-03-15 08:36
基于iTop-4412的U-Boot 2017移植[0]:Exynos4412基础
基于iTop-4412的U-Boot2017移植[0]:Exynos4412基础参考资料:Exynos4412的启动过程分析基于
tiny4412
的u-boot移植Exynos4412SoC基础-Exynos4412
techping
·
2020-03-02 02:32
1.
Tiny4412
开发板介绍
我贴出板子上的外设:
Tiny4412
基本外设芯片类型与性能如下:芯片类型:三星四核A9Exynos4412主频:1.5GHZRAM:1GDDR3存储:4GeMMC高速闪存另外说一点:使用的板子是友善出的
wit_yuan
·
2019-12-19 11:43
linux驱动:编写最简单的内核模块helloWorld并移植到ARM板
环境:主机-Ubuntu16.04,开发板-友善之臂
tiny4412
开发板,内核版本linux-3.5参考《Linux设备驱动开发详解基于最新的Linux4.0内核》(宋宝华编著)一、简介一个Linux
Mr_zengzr
·
2019-10-21 20:58
linux
driver
《
tiny4412
启动》
参考:https://blog.csdn.net/qq_23922117/article/details/783129081.编译uboota)安装好toolchain(arm-linux-gcc-4.5.1-v6-vfp-20120301.tgz)并设置好环境变量PATH,保证可以正常使用。sudotar-xvfarm-linux-gcc-4.5.1-v6-vfp-20120301.tgz–C/
一个不知道干嘛的小萌新
·
2019-09-19 09:00
基于
Tiny4412
的DS18B20温度传感器驱动
首先,在虚拟机中新建名为linux-3的文件夹,从光盘中将linux-3.5-20170221.tgz(此文件由于过大无法上传,可私信我)压缩包拷入到此文件夹中。在此文件夹中将压缩包解压,得到linux-3.5文件夹。将编写好的驱动程序代码ds18b20.c(驱动程序代码可到我的资源中下载)放入/linux-3/linux-3.5/drivers/char中。如图所示:接下来配置Kconfig文件
EverestRs
·
2019-07-14 13:31
嵌入式
基于
Tiny4412
的DS18B20温度传感器驱动
首先,在虚拟机中新建名为linux-3的文件夹,从光盘中将linux-3.5-20170221.tgz(此文件由于过大无法上传,可私信我)压缩包拷入到此文件夹中。在此文件夹中将压缩包解压,得到linux-3.5文件夹。将编写好的驱动程序代码ds18b20.c(驱动程序代码可到我的资源中下载)放入/linux-3/linux-3.5/drivers/char中。如图所示:接下来配置Kconfig文件
EverestRs
·
2019-07-14 13:31
嵌入式
记录自己哈啰单车面试经历--笔试题及自己的理解
stm32和
tiny4412
的区别是什么
夜色正凄凉
·
2019-07-06 10:38
Linux电源管理
本博文对应地址:https://hceng.cn/2018/01/18/Linux电源管理/#more探究Linux电源管理模型,并为
Tiny4412
的LCD驱动添加电源管理。
hceng_blog
·
2019-05-06 09:56
嵌入式基础
Linux驱动
基于ARM+Linux系统的智能家居系统
系统采用
Tiny4412
开发板作为中控端,节点使用了两个stm32开发板,通信采用zigbee模块,包含了安防系统,照明系统,环境系统等,并且拥有良好的人机交互界面。
夜色正凄凉
·
2019-04-09 13:55
Android为
Tiny4412
设备驱动在proc目录下添加一个可读版本信息的文件
https://www.jb51.net/article/152879.htm上节,我们明白了proc文件系统的作用,接下来我们在已经写好的led驱动的基础上,在proc目录下创建一个文件夹,然后加入led驱动的版本信息读取。我们在init函数的最后加入://定义proc文件系统节点structproc_dir_entry*dev_dir,*dev_version;//创建一个目录dev_dir=
Engineer-Bruce_Yang
·
2018-12-19 09:14
一步步学习基于Linux4.4的
TINY4412
开发--uboot的移植
开发板:
tiny4412
-1506储存4G、内存1G系统:ubuntu16.04虚拟机u-boot:u-boot2010.12compiledtool:arm-none-linux-gnueabi-gcc
colouring絮
·
2018-06-11 16:34
tiny4412
Linux内核驱动
Tiny4412
从零搭建linux系统之从SD卡启动
https://blog.csdn.net/tech_pro/article/details/80269751这篇文章讲了一下如何从emmc中启动系统,本文来说一下如何从SD卡中启动系统。一、对SD卡进行分区并格式化SD卡首先从emmc中启动系统,然后执行如下命令来对SD卡进行分区和格式化:fdisk-c13202057520fatformatmmc1:1ext3formatmmc1:2ext3f
TECH_PRO
·
2018-05-10 21:00
嵌入式系统移植
嵌入式系统搭建
配置和安装
Tiny4412
使用superboot安装启动安卓/Linux/UbuntuCore系统, 使用SD-Flasher烧写
硬件平台:
Tiny4412
/Super4412SDK1506LCD:S702折腾了几天烧写系统,先是利用SD卡烧写系统,结果最后利用fastboot烧写光盘提供的system.img文件时,下位机提示imagetoolargeforpartition
_hello_cc
·
2018-04-27 11:17
Tiny4412
【
TINY4412
】U-BOOT移植笔记:(19)TFTP更新固件
【
TINY4412
】U-BOOT移植笔记:(19)TFTP更新固件宿主机:虚拟机Ubuntu16.04LTS/X64目标板[底板]:
Tiny4412
SDK-1506目标板[核心板]:
Tiny4412
-1412U-BOOT
大水猫
·
2018-01-13 08:36
TINY4412
U-BOOT
Bridge(桥接)模式
案例:某公司的产品有智能仪表和智能网关,可供选择的处理器有AM3352、S3C2440和
tiny4412
,智能仪表可以选择这3种处理器之一,同样智能网关也可以。
echo_bright_
·
2018-01-11 18:42
C++设计模式
tiny4412
内核自带led驱动分析
内核版本:linux-3.5平台:
tiny4412
一、关于混杂设备此版本内核led驱动使用的是混杂设备misc,具体misc.c的实现路径:linux-3.5/drivers/char/misc.c这就很大程度简化了我们的驱动代码
qicheng777
·
2017-11-11 12:04
tiny4412驱动
移植Uboot2017到
TINY4412
梦想还是要有的,万一实现了呢移植相关硬件:-核心板:
Tiny4412
-1412-底板:
Tiny4412
/Super4412SDK1506软件:-移植uboot版本:u-boot-2017.05.tar.bz2
Deadline_h
·
2017-09-03 18:12
uboot
tiny4412
学习(一)之从零搭建linux系统(烧写uboot、内核进emmc+uboot启动内核)
硬件平台:
tiny4412
系统:linux-3.5-20151029文件系统:busybox-1.22.1.tar.bz2编译器:arm-linux-gcc-4.5.1目的:使用uboot引导linux
【星星之火】
·
2017-07-01 23:11
tiny4412
linux-4.4
uboot
emmc
【内核驱动】 内核驱动中添加系统调用
开发环境:Redhat6.5开发板:
Tiny4412
(ARMCortexA9)1.系统调用概述系统调用请点击系统调用概述2.实现系统调用的步骤添加一个系统调用比较简单,下面以添加add函数来讲解下添加过程
沧海一笑-dj
·
2017-04-06 11:37
Linux驱动
手把手教你写第一个Linux驱动程序
我这里以我的开发环境
tiny4412
为主,我将在这上面写第一个驱动程序。
weixin_34008784
·
2017-01-19 22:00
设备树学习之(九)SPI设备注册过程
开发板:
tiny4412
SDK+S702+4GBFlash要移植的内核版本:Linux-4.4.0(支持devicetree)u-boot版本:友善之臂自带的U-Boot2010.12busybox版本
Linux学习之路
·
2017-01-15 22:02
Tiny4412
Device
Tree
DTS之Tiny4412
基於
tiny4412
的Linux內核移植--- 中斷和GPIO學習(3)
作者彭東林
[email protected]
平臺
tiny4412
ADKLinux-4.4.4u-boot使用的U-Boot2010.12,是友善自帶的,爲支持設備樹和uImage做了稍許改動簡介前面我們實現了一種設備樹下中斷的使用方法
摩斯电码
·
2016-12-25 23:00
Linux驱动学习 —— 在/sys下面创建目录示例
[root@
tiny4412
mnt]#ls-R/sys/sysfs_demo/ /sys/sysfs_demo/: node_onenode_twosysfs_demo_2 /sys/sysfs_demo
摩斯电码
·
2016-12-24 15:00
使用ssh远程连接开发板
准备
tiny4412
开发板烧录Ubuntucore步骤1.将开发板联网2.安装ssh服务sudoapt-getinstallopenssh-server顺带备忘下相关命令启动、停止和重启SSH:sudo
chuncanL
·
2016-12-03 22:05
arm
基於
tiny4412
的Linux內核移植--- 中斷和GPIO學習(2)
作者彭東林
[email protected]
平臺
tiny4412
ADKLinux-4.4.4u-boot使用的U-Boot2010.12,是友善自帶的,爲支持設備樹和uImage做了稍許改動概述這篇博客以一個簡單的
摩斯电码
·
2016-11-20 23:00
基於
tiny4412
的Linux內核移植--- 中斷和GPIO學習(1)
作者彭東林
[email protected]
平臺
tiny4412
ADKLinux-4.4.4u-boot使用的U-Boot2010.12,是友善自帶的,爲支持設備樹和uImage做了稍許改動概述這篇博客以一個簡單的按鍵中斷來演示一下有了設備樹後的中斷的使用
摩斯电码
·
2016-11-20 16:00
基于
tiny4412
的Linux内核移植 ---- 調試方法
作者信息彭東林郵箱:
[email protected]
平臺Linux-4.4.4uboot使用的是友善自帶的(爲了支持uImage和設備樹做了稍許修改)概述這篇博客主要用於匯總一下調試方法。正文1.dnw下載目前我將uboot燒寫到SD卡中,然後使用dnw將kernel、根文件系統以及設備樹鏡像下載到內存中,爲了提高效率,可以使用下面的方法:在uboot中添加環境變量:setenvdnw
摩斯电码
·
2016-11-19 15:00
Android ServiceManager源码(一)-- C语言部分
android5.0/android-5.0.2/device/friendly-arm/
tiny4412
/conf/init.rc524serviceservicemanager/system/bin
冬の雷と夏の雪
·
2016-09-12 18:14
arm
linux
android
c
Linux内核移植--开机logo
0开发环境 Host:Ubuntu14.04 Target:
Tiny4412
Kernel:linux-3.1.0 1默认logo 默认开机logo会在液晶屏的左上脚显示一只小企鹅,分辨率为80
Q1302182594
·
2016-08-26 16:00
友善之臂
tiny4412
-1306开发板安卓系统烧写
首先,我们需要有一个基于
tiny4412
的kernel,从友善之臂官网获取。
morixinguan
·
2016-07-24 18:00
Android应用程序通过JNI控制LED
PC机:ubuntu12.04.5开发板:
tiny4412
Android版本:5.0.2AndroidIDE:AndroidStudio前提:PC机已经搭建好Android开发环境,已经安装好交叉编译器
wenjs0620
·
2016-06-16 09:00
android
jni
C语言
native
android应用
基于
tiny4412
搭建Android开发环境
PC主机:ubuntu12.04开发板:
tiny4412
前提:保证PC机能连接互联网,并使用ubuntu的官方源执行sudoapt-getupdate在使用ubuntu12.04.5搭建Android开发环境时
wenjs0620
·
2016-06-13 10:00
android
Android开发
脚本
ubuntu
pc
使用IO映射的方式获取
tiny4412
板子上的ID号
在以前的文章中,有一篇 基于ARM-contexA9-Linux驱动开发:如何获取板子上独有的ID号在那篇文章中,具体可以参考。那时候我使用了简单的字符设备驱动框架,最终的ID号通过read方法可将ID读取出来,但是,这样做就太麻烦啦,有没有更简单的方法呢?其实有,这种方法称作IO地址的映射,而今天我们要说的是IO地址的动态映射方法,静态映射就太简单了,直接调用相应的接口,配置相应的寄存器,设置状
morixinguan
·
2016-05-16 14:00
《Linux驱动》驱动注册
包含驱动的结构体和注册和卸载的函数*/ #include #defineDRIVER_NAME"hello_ctl" /*设备注册所需的名字,在内核/arch/arm/mach-exynos/mach-
tiny4412
HERGhost
·
2016-05-12 11:00
函数
内核
结构
linux驱动
tiny4412
配置kernel
编译linux内核makemenuconfig需ncurses,Ubuntu命令:sudoapt-getinstalllibncurses5-dev
beijiwei
·
2016-04-07 23:00
Tiny4412
开发板 编译环境搭建
********************************************************************************** * Function :
Tiny4412
beijiwei
·
2016-04-04 11:00
入手友善之臂Cortex-A9
Tiny4412
开发板
发货清单:1:
Tiny4412
核心板和
Tiny4412
SDK1506标准版开发参考底板
beijiwei
·
2016-04-04 09:00
Tiny4412
led之JNI实现
硬件平台:
Tiny4412
标准版+android5.0
Tiny4412
硬件电路从电路原理图可以知道LED灯连接到处理器的GPM4的0-3端口,且LED被上拉到3.3V的源,只有GPIO口输出低电平时就能点亮
u010245383
·
2016-03-31 11:00
jni
led
tiny4412
基于
tiny4412
的Linux内核移植 -- DM9621NP网卡驱动移植(四)
转自:http://www.07net01.com/2016/01/1177282.html作者信息作者:彭东林邮箱:
[email protected]
:405728433平台简介开发板:
tiny4412
ADK
sunjing_
·
2016-03-22 17:00
上一页
2
3
4
5
6
7
8
9
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他